State urges vaccinations to fight equine encephalitis

The state is urging Florida horse owners to vaccinate their animals due to an upsurge in eastern equine encephalitis.

Agriculture Commissioner Charles Bronson said today that 16 cases have been confirmed this year.

Bronson said most have been in central and north central Florida, which is normal.

The horse malady and West Nile virus, though, also have turned up in blood tests on sentinel chickens used to check for both mosquito-borne diseases in the southern part of Florida.

Humans also can contract the diseases although eastern equine encephalitis is rare because mosquitoes that carry it prefer other animals.

Horses also can get West Nile virus but no cases have been reported.
